Book Description Hardcover. Condition: Near Fine. Dust Jacket Condition: Very Good. Edward Ardizzone (illustrator). 1st Edition. A title in Bodley Head's "Fairy Tale Picture Books" series under the general editorship of Kathleen Lines. Illustrated with alternate spreads in color and black & white by the ever-wonderful Ardizzone. Lines contributes an essay at the back of the book about the origins of the "Babes in the Wood" ballad.
